Output 25245131bb844072d8a066eec5244e87afe2dd52025888469cbe681372e88ffe:1

value
6371633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de5f942c335f732f097600a7a37762dd61b4383 OP_EQUAL
address
3MvJknjbbz4AGMWznUL2smyetURBsbJUwb
transaction
25245131bb844072d8a066eec5244e87afe2dd52025888469cbe681372e88ffe
confirmations
288730
spent
true